Buying Guide: How to Choose the Right Heavy Duty Storage Shelves
After testing 10 different heavy duty storage shelves, I learned that picking the right unit comes down to matching your specific needs with the right combination of capacity, dimensions, and features. Here’s how to make a confident decision based on what actually matters.
Weight Capacity and What You Actually Need
Weight capacity is the most-cited spec for heavy duty shelving, but the numbers require context. Manufacturers rate shelving for evenly distributed loads, which means a 350 lb per shelf rating assumes the weight is spread across the entire shelf surface. Concentrating weight in one spot dramatically reduces effective capacity.
For most home garage applications, 350 lbs per shelf is more than sufficient. Tools, paint cans, and typical household items rarely exceed 200 lbs per shelf in real-world use. For commercial or industrial applications where you store engine parts, bulk supplies, or heavy inventory, look for 600+ lbs per shelf ratings like the Seville Classics UltraDurable or workpro units.
Material and Build Quality
All the shelves in this roundup use steel construction, but the specifics vary. Look for solid steel (not stamped or hollow tubes), reinforced welding at stress points, and powder-coated finishes for rust resistance. Chrome-plated finishes look attractive but show fingerprints and may not resist corrosion as well as powder coating in humid environments.
Steel gauge matters too. Lower gauge numbers mean thicker steel, which translates to higher load capacity and longer life. Unfortunately, most manufacturers don’t publish gauge specifications, so you’ll need to rely on weight ratings and user reviews as proxies for build quality.
Dimensions and Footprint Considerations
Measure your available floor space before ordering. Standard shelving widths range from 30 to 79 inches, and depths run from 14 to 24 inches. The 48-inch width works for most garage spaces because it fits between standard wall studs and leaves room for vehicle parking.
Also measure your doorways. Several units in this roundup (like the SISESOL and reibii) require 55-79 inch door widths for delivery. If your access points are narrow, choose a unit with a smaller assembled footprint or one that ships disassembled in smaller boxes.
Assembly Type and Difficulty
Boltless designs (no tools required) are the fastest to assemble, typically 10-20 minutes for a full unit. Bolted designs take longer (30-60 minutes) but may offer slightly higher load capacities. Press-to-assemble designs fall in the middle on time but offer the cleanest finished appearance.
For most users, boltless or press-to-assemble designs provide the best combination of speed and strength. Reserve bolted designs for applications where you need maximum rigidity and don’t mind longer assembly.
Adjustability and Shelf Spacing
Most heavy duty shelving offers 1-inch shelf height adjustability, which provides enough flexibility for most storage needs. If you frequently store items of varying heights, prioritize units with clearly marked adjustment holes and slip sleeves that hold shelves securely.
Fixed-shelf units cost less but limit your flexibility. For a one-time storage solution with consistent items, fixed shelves work fine. For evolving storage needs, adjustable shelves are worth the small price premium.
NSF Certification and Safety
NSF certification matters if you’re storing food items, using shelving in commercial kitchens, or running a food-related business. The certification confirms the shelving meets public health standards for direct food contact storage. For home garage storage of tools and equipment, NSF certification isn’t required but indicates higher build quality standards.
For safety with any tall shelving unit, anchor the unit to the wall using L-brackets or similar hardware. Even the most stable shelving can tip if a child climbs on it or if loaded unevenly. Wall anchoring takes 10 minutes and prevents potentially dangerous accidents.
Warranty and Long-Term Value
Warranty length is a strong signal of manufacturer confidence. Seville Classics offers 10-year warranties on their commercial-grade units, while budget options like Whitmor offer 30-day parts replacement. Longer warranties indicate that the manufacturer expects the product to last, which usually correlates with better materials and quality control.
For a unit you’ll use daily for years, the slightly higher upfront cost of a warranted product pays for itself through longer life and lower replacement frequency.

How much weight can a storage shelf hold?
Heavy duty storage shelves typically hold between 1,200 and 6,000 lbs total, with per-shelf ratings ranging from 300 to 1,500 lbs. These ratings apply to evenly distributed loads. Concentrating weight in one area of a shelf dramatically reduces effective capacity. Most home garage applications only need 350 lbs per shelf, while commercial and industrial uses may require 600+ lbs per shelf. Always check the manufacturer’s specific rating for your chosen unit.

Are wire shelves strong enough for garage storage?
Yes, wire shelves are strong enough for most garage storage applications. Quality wire shelving uses welded steel construction with reinforcement at stress points, delivering 300-800 lbs per shelf capacity. Wire shelves offer advantages over solid shelving including better air circulation (preventing moisture buildup), improved visibility of stored items, and lighter weight for easier assembly. For extremely heavy items over 800 lbs per shelf, solid steel shelving may be more appropriate.
What wood is good for heavy duty shelves?
While most heavy duty shelving uses steel construction, wood options exist for certain applications. For wooden heavy duty shelves, hardwoods like oak, maple, and birch offer the best load capacity. Plywood with multiple plies (3/4 inch thickness minimum) also works well. However, for true heavy duty applications over 500 lbs per shelf, steel construction is superior in strength, durability, and fire resistance. Wood shelving is best for workshops where you need a work surface or for aesthetic applications in finished spaces.
